South Korea - Import of Tools for Working in the Hand with Non-Electric Motor
Since 2014, South Korea Import of Tools for Working in the Hand with Non-Electric Motor decreased by 2.6% year on year. At $31,512,990.54 in 2019, the country was ranked number 19 among other countries in Import of Tools for Working in the Hand with Non-Electric Motor. South Korea is overtaken by Brazil, which was number 18 with $33,498,635.58 and is followed by Argentina with $29,658,672.11. United States lead the ranking with $441,894,734.09 in 2019, +3% versus 2018. France, Germany and United Kingdom resp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Burundi recorded the best 5 years average growth at +210.1% per year, while Sao Tome and Principe witnessed the worst performance at -48.7% per year.
